Home roof installation services involve the complete process of replacing an existing roof or installing a new roof on a residential property. This service typically includes removing the old roofing material, inspecting the underlying structure for any damage, and then installing the chosen roofing materials such as asphalt shingles, metal panels, or other options. Experienced contractors ensure that the new roof is properly secured, sealed, and built to withstand local weather conditions. Homeowners seeking a roof installation may be upgrading an aging roof, building a new home, or replacing a damaged roof to improve safety and curb appeal.
These services help address a variety of common roofing problems. For instance, leaks caused by aging or damaged shingles can lead to water intrusion and interior damage. Warped or cracked roofing materials may compromise the roof’s integrity, increasing the risk of leaks or structural issues. Additionally, a roof that has reached the end of its lifespan may no longer provide adequate protection from the elements. Installing a new roof can resolve these issues, preventing further damage and helping to maintain the structural integrity of the home.

The overview below groups typical Home Roof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Kitsap County, WA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or roof repairs, such as replacing shingles or fixing leaks, generally range from $250-$600. Most routine jobs fall within this middle band, depending on the extent of damage and materials needed.
Partial Roof Replacement - When only part of a roof needs replacement, costs usually range from $1,000-$3,500. Local contractors often handle these projects within this range, though larger or more complex partial replacements can go higher.
Full Roof Replacement - Complete roof replacements in the area tend to cost between $5,000 and $12,000, with larger or more intricate roofs reaching higher prices. Many projects fall into the $7,000-$10,000 range, depending on materials and roof size.
High-End or Complex Projects - Larger, custom, or complex roof installations can exceed $15,000, especially for high-end materials or challenging architecture. Such projects are less common but can be necessary for extensive renovations or premium materials.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
